170925-N-WB378-0096 PUERTO RICO, (Sept. 25, 2017) – A Landing Craft Utility, assigned to Assault Craft Unit Two, departs the beach after unloading troops and cargo in Puerto Rico, Sept. 25, 2017. The Department of Defense is supporting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A), the lead federal agency, in helping those affected by Hurricane Maria to minimize suffering and is one component of the overall whole-of-government response effort. (U.S. Navy photo by Mass Communication Specialist 1st Class Blake Midnight/RELEASED)
